Climate change poses a serious threat to Earth and its inhabitants. There is now substantial evidence that human activity is causing global warming because of our large emissions of greenhouse gases. For instance, atmospheric carbon dioxide currently measures at three hundred and ninety seven parts per million, which is the highest it has been for at least the past one million years (National Research Council of the National Academies). Also, scientific data shows that Earth’s average surface temperature has increased more than 1.7 Fahrenheit over the past one hundred years (National Research Council of the National Academies). The evidence is unequivocal that our activities are the main culprit to the disruption of the climate system. In 2013, the top four emitters of carbon dioxide totaled to fifty-eight percent of entire global emissions (Loiseau). Among these four, China is the largest, accounting for twenty-eight percent (Loiseau). The United States accounted for fourteen percent; The EU accounted for ten percent; And India accounted for seven percent (Loiseau). Specifically, China’s total annual carbon dioxide emissions amounted to a massive 8.3 billion metric tons while the United States emitted 5.4 billion metric tons annually (Loiseau). India followed China and the United States with just over 2 billion metric tons emitted annually (Loiseau). This data could, however, be somewhat misleading. Green buildings could become one of the main factors to preserve our rapidly decaying environment. There is no easy way to define a green building, but a green building is essentially a structure that amplifies the positives and mitigates the negatives throughout the entire life cycle of the building (Kriss, 2014). There are many definitions for a green building, but all of them include the planning, designing, constructing, and operating of the building while taking into huge considerations of the energy use, water use, indoor air environment, materials used and the effect it has on the site the green building is being built on. The first green buildings dates back to as far as the 1970’s, when solar panels went from experiments to reality. Green buildings were not as popular as they are today due to their extremely high pricing. With technology rapidly growing, solar panels are becoming cheaper and cheaper, making the transition to creating green buildings more affordable. This is the primary reason for the increased growth of green buildings today. A modern company that is paving the way to the growth of green buildings named LEED, Leadership in Energy and Environmental Design, focuses primarily on new and effective ideas for environmentally friendly buildings projects. With more than 60,000 commercial projects worldwide and 1.7 million square feet being certified every day, LEED is one of the leading groups for promoting green buildings. Climate change is one of the fastest growing concerns in today’s society. The effects of climate change have already been seen across the world in the form of trees and plants flowering sooner, loss of sea ice, shrinking glaciers and longer heat waves . These effects will only increase over time. One of the causes of climate change is increased emission of green house gases (GHG). As a consequence governments worldwide are working towards implementing legislation to reduce these effects, one of which is to encourage people to make properties more sustainable. The focus here will be on Dr Johnson’s house, which is a 300 year old townhouse located within the City of London at 17 Gough Square, London, EC4A 3DE (see Appendix 1 for location). This old property has had little done to it to reduce GHG. As it will be sold to house an administrative section of the government department, a number of sustainable improvements will be analysed, along with legislation that should be taken into consideration when doing so. Furthermore, the provisions in the case that the property was located in a EU member state and if it was located in a country that is not a EU member will also be examined.
